J-R Auger sits in Jefferson County, Ohio, where the Census mining category is 1.2% of county employment.

Local economic context
County figures come from the US Census Bureau's American Community Survey, 5-year pooled estimates, so the 2023 vintage covers 2019 through 2023. The Census category is 'mining, quarrying, and oil and gas extraction', which is broader than MSHA jurisdiction and includes oil and gas workers no mine employs. These figures describe the surrounding county, not this mine, and are not a factor in any specific incident.

1987 · 1 incident

October 21, 1987 OH · Coal auger helper POWERED HAULAGE
Tri-State Auger Mining Inc · Struck against a moving object

EMPLOYEE WAS SE3T TO TOP OF RAMP TO START & BRING TRUCK WITH THE FUEL TANK DOWN INTO THE PIT HE WAS BACKING SAID TRUCK DOWN THE RAMP WHEN A AIR HOSE RUPTURED CAUSING BRAKES TO FAIL DUE TO LOW AIR PRESSURE TR6CK STRUCK A ROCK TRUCK PARKED AT THE PIT LEVEL THE IMPACT CAUSED I.NAME TO BE DRIVEN BACKWARD IN THE SEAT
